Associate Professor Mihir Gandhi
Adjunct Scientist
PhD, Cstat, CSci
Concurrent Appointments:
Head of Biostatistics, Singapore Clinical Research Institute
Head – Biostatistics Core & Assistant Professor, Centre for Quantitative Medicine, Duke-NUS Medical School
Assistant Professor, Lien Centre for Palliative Care
Assistant Professor, SingHealth Duke-NUS Global Health Institute
Visiting Researcher, Global Health Group, Center for Child Health Research, Tampere University, Finland
Associate Professor Gandhi received his Bachelor and Masters degree with the first rank gold medal in Statistics from the MS University of Baroda, India and a PhD degree from Tampere University, Finland. He had worked as a biostatistician in leading multinational pharmaceutical companies, clinical research organizations, and academia in India and Singapore.
Associate Professor Gandhi's research interests lie in quality of life measurement, health services research, oncology, child growth and development, as well as applied medical statistics.
